Investar Q2 FY26 net income available to common shareholders drops 22.2% to $8.94 million; net interest margin widens 8 basis points to 3.67%
  • Investar posted net income available to common shareholders of USD 8.9 million, or USD 0.61 per diluted share, in Q2 2026.
  • Earnings fell 22.2% from Q1 2026, while net interest margin widened 0.08 percentage points to 3.67%.
  • Return on average assets slipped to 0.98% from 1.25%, while the overall cost of funds eased to 2.31% from 2.40%.
  • Total loans edged down 0.3% to USD 3.06 billion, while the business lending portfolio rose 3.8% to USD 1.21 billion.
  • Completed Wichita Falls Bancshares operational conversion in May; repurchased 27,235 shares at an average USD 27.68, raised dividend 9% to USD 0.12.
